The ESUMIC RG6 RG59 Coax Cable Compression Crimper Tool Kit is a professional-grade, 3-in-1 solution featuring a precision 20.3mm compression distance, adjustable dual-blade cable stripper, and high-quality nickel-plated waterproof connectors. Designed for durability and ergonomic comfort, it supports a wide range of coaxial cables and connectors, making it essential for satellite, CCTV, and broadband installations.

Great value and workes well
Used it several times to add an F-connector to RG6 coaxial cable. Cutting tool works very well. Crimper also works well but I found that you do not have to close the crimper the whole way to crimp the F-connector just until the blue plastic is pushed inside the metal jacket.

Ok tool
As many people have indicated, the connectors do not compress properly and hold on without a proper wire strip and proper wire. I used RG6 U quad-shield. They slide right off without addressing these variables. A little bit of a learning curve. After folding back both layers of shielding with a proper 1/4" core exposed, I got a solid crimp every time. I couldn't pull off the connector.
